CastlesBristol Castle [Ruins] - Castle Park, Bristol, UK

in Castles

All that remains of Bristol Castle, built in the 11th/12th centuries, are ruins of the keep in Castle Park. The castle was demolished in 1656 with a surviving turret being pilled down in 1927. The ruins are a Scheduled Ancient Monument.

This Old ChurchSt Peter's Church - Castle Park, Bristol, UK

in This Old Church

St Peter's church was built between the 12th and 15th centuries. It was bombed in the Second World War and has not been repaired but maintained as a meorial to the civilians who died during the Second World War.

Holy WellsSt Edith's Well - Castle Park, Bristol, UK

in Holy Wells

St Edith's Well is located in the grounds of Castle Park close to the ruined church of St Peter. Reference is made to the well in 1391. Restoration work was undertaken in 2016 and the bore of the well can now be seen through a glass pavement.

Dated Buildings and Cornerstones1701 - Merchant Taylor's Almshouses - Merchant Street, Bristol, UK

in Dated Buildings and Cornerstones

The Merchant Taylor's Almshouses were built in 1701 and consisted of nine dwellings - three in each section. Today, the building is used for retail purposes. The date is adjacent to a coat-of-arms above the central entrance door.

Wikipedia EntriesBlackfriars - Broadmead, Bristol, UK

in Wikipedia Entries

Blackfriars was a Dominican priory in Broadmead, Bristol and was founded by Maurice de Gaunt in 1227 as advised by a plaque on one of the buildings. Three buildings make up the priory: Bakers' Hall, New Hall and Cutlers' Hall.

This Old ChurchSt Nicholas Church - Baldwin Street, Bristol, UK

in This Old Church

The church was initially built in the mid 14th century with the church being rebuilt from the crypt up in 1769. The church was bombed in the Second World War and restored in 1975. It reopened as an Anglican church in 2018 after 60 years of other use.
